People are now more conscious of the products that make it into their home – in terms of what they put into their body, on their skin AND what they clean their home with.

The approach to cleaning our homes and businesses has changed hugely over the past couple of years.

The focus now is on what is best for our body, our wellbeing, and the environment.

Less in now certainly more……. less additives, less chemicals, less packaging.

Yorkshire Businesswoman member, Mo, founder of Yorkshire based wellbeing brand, Snug Aromatics has over 20 years’ experience as an aromatherapist and created her brand from her kitchen table. All the blends used in Snug products have been created by Mo and now found in some of the UK’s most prestigious establishments, including Athelis Gyms, Braywood House Estate, Elmore Court, Grantley Hall Hotel and Matfen Hall.

The Snug range started with home fragrance products but has since grown to include body and bath products, an aromatherapy dog range and in late 2024, the new eco cleaning range was launched. The feedback since launch has been phenomenal.

Mo explains that the use of aromatic plants dates to the beginning of civilisation and the essential oils extracted from these plants are well known for their healing powers on the body and mind, as well as having antibacterial, anti-fungal, degreasing, deodorising and insect repellent properties. Mo continues that launching a cleaning range was a natural addition to the Snug product range; “our scents are already known and loved by our customers so to include these in a natural cleaning product made perfect sense”.

Instead of having several single use plastic bottles filled with harsh chemicals in your cupboards, you can now have one 500ml glass bottle for life which can be filled with a multi-surface cleaning concentrate, topped up with water from your tap and used throughout your home.

Mo concludes that “as a wellbeing brand, kindness to us and the environment is of upmost importance. Instead of using harsh chemicals, we let nature do the work”.

The cleaning range is available in 8 Snug scents and the range will be growing later this year to include laundry products.
